What is Prompt Engineering?
Prompt engineering involves crafting the input given to AI models to elicit the best and most relevant responses. Just like a sculptor chisels away stone to reveal a masterpiece, prompt engineers mold their queries to uncover the richest outputs from AI.

The Art of Crafting Effective Prompts
Creating effective prompts is both an art and a science. Here are some tips:
- Be Specific: Instead of asking, “Tell me about cats,” try, “What are the most common cat breeds and their characteristics?” This specificity encourages detailed responses.
- Context Matters: Providing context helps the AI understand your expectations. Instead of saying, “Write a story,” you could say, “Write a fantasy story about a young girl who discovers she has magical powers.”
- Iterative Approach: Don’t be afraid to refine your prompts based on initial outputs. If the response isn’t what you expected, adjust your question accordingly.

Challenges in Prompt Engineering
Despite its advantages, prompt engineering is not without challenges:
- Over-Specification: Providing too many details may clutter the AI’s output, leading to confusion.
- Bias in Responses: A poorly worded prompt can encourage biased or stereotypical responses, necessitating careful consideration of language.
- Understanding the AI’s Limitations: Knowing the capabilities and constraints of a given AI model is vital. Some systems may not understand highly abstract concepts or nuanced prompts.
